## Changelog — Marchetta Renderer v3.8.2

Rotated the signing key used by the Marchetta markdown rendering pipeline. All rendered document bundles published after this release are signed with the new key; bundles signed with the retired key will still verify until the grace window closes at end of month. Support team: if a customer reports a verification failure on freshly rendered output, confirm their verifier cache was refreshed, since stale caches are the most common cause. For reference when assisting customers, the new key appears below.

deploy key for kajof-fajop: bky6_gDHw9Q

### Step 4: Bulk Edits in the Admin Table

Welcome aboard! Before pushing the Mirebrook release, use the admin table's bulk-edit mode to flip all staging rows to `active` — don't do them one by one, you'll be there all day. Once that's done, authenticate the deploy job with the key below.

release key, fahaf-bajof: bky3_Xam

Management Meeting Minutes — Branfield Office Closure

Attendees: R. Tavish, L. Okonde, J. Merriweather.

Decision confirmed: Branfield office closes end of quarter. Lease break exercised; penalty within provision. Seven staff offered relocation to Thornmoor; two declined, redundancy terms per policy. IT decommissioning booked. One-off closure cost estimated at 85k, annual saving 210k. Finance to reflect both in the reforecast. Rationale and next steps are summarised in the note below.

internal memo for bahap-yagug: Headcount on the Ulaix team goes from 3 to 100 by the end of January. Gross margin on Ulaix came in at 10 percent against a plan of 15 percent.

Audit Item 14: Nightly Backfill Scheduler (Project Marlowick). Verify that the Duskrunner scheduler triggered all backfill jobs between 01:00 and 04:00 local time, and that retry counts stayed below three per job. New team members should also confirm the completion manifest was written to the Harrowfen archive and cross-check row counts against the previous night. Any discrepancy, however small, must be logged before sign-off. Escalate unresolved gaps to the owner named below.

named custodian: Brivan Eliath Quenox Frador